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 pound beef belly (sliced into strips)
  • 6 cups chicken broth
  • 34 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 2 tablespoons sesame oil
  • 3 garlic cloves (minced)
  • 2 teaspoons ginger (minced)
  • 1 cup shiitake mushrooms (sliced)
  • 6 oz ramen noodles
  • Optional: Soft boiled eggs, green onions for topping

Instructions

  1. Heat olive oil in a Dutch oven over medium-high heat. Sear the beef belly slices until crispy; remove from pot.
  2. Drain excess fat but leave some for flavor. Add garlic, ginger, carrots, and mushrooms to sauté until softened.
  3. Deglaze the pot with chicken broth while scraping up brown bits on the bottom.
  4. Stir in soy sauce, sesame oil, and rice apple vinegar. Cook uncovered for about 10 minutes.
  5. Add ramen noodles and cook until softened.
  6. Serve hot topped with beef belly slices and optional boiled eggs.
